Daesang Corp. announced on June 8 that the company held a ceremony in honor of the completion of an astaxathin plant at Gunsan Bio Plant with Jeong Hong-Eun, president of Daesang Corp. and Takahide Kasai, president of JXTG Nippon Oil & Energy.

The ceremony is quite meaningful in that the company will begin production on a full scale after the successful completion of facility investment and a test run of the plant. Daesang Corp. signed an astaxathin supply contact with JXTG NOE in March last year.

Daesang Corp. is planning to supply astaxathin, which is used as a fish feed coloring agent and an ingredient for health functional food to JXTG NOE, the largest energy and refining company in Japan. The initial contract amount is expected to reach 30 billion won (US$27 million) and sales are expected to swell further as demand increases.

Astaxathin is a powerful antioxidant that is 550 times more potent than vitamin E, and is mainly used as a coloring agent for aquaculture feed for salmons, trout, and shrimps. Besides, Astaxathin is used as a health functional food ingredient to prevent the failing of eyesight, Alzheimer’s and Parkinson’s diseases and heart diseases due to aging, and prevent skin damage by ultraviolet rays.

"Daesang Corp. started commercial production of astaxathin in earnest for the first time in Korea in about one year since concluding a supply agreement as its excellent fermentation production facility and manufacturing technology were recognized last year,” said Jeong Hong-Eun, president of Daesang Corp. "We will stably supply astaxathin of excellent quality based on our 60 years’ know-how in fermentation and JXTG NOE's astaxathin manufacturing know-how."
